MODELO ENTIDAD RELACION/ MER- EXTENDIDO
Enviado por Pedro Sotelo Bautista • 2 de Agosto de 2021 • Tarea • 1.184 Palabras (5 Páginas) • 203 Visitas
UNIVERSIDAD RICARDO PALMA FACULTAD DE INGENIERIA ESCUELA DE INGENIERIA INFORMATICA[pic 1]
CICLO 2021-I
ASIGNATURA: BASE DE DATOS I
GUÍA 02: MODELO ENTIDAD RELACION/ MER- EXTENDIDO
- COMPETENCIAS
- Define e identifica un Modelo de Datos
- Construye un modelo entidad relación
REFERENCIAS CONCEPTUALES
- Emplear software de modelamiento.
OBJETIVOS SEMANA
- Reconocer un modelo de datos y construye un modelo entidad relación con notación IE.
- Construir modelos entidad relación
- INTRODUCCION
El modelamientos de datos mediante esta técnica (MER) aparece en la década del 70 creado por Peter Chen. El primer paso para diseñar una Base de Datos es realizar el modelo entidad relación en base a los requerimientos del usuario ver figura 0. El primer paso es realizar el Diseño Conceptual que produce un esquema conceptual que es nuestro Diagrama Entidad Relación.
Modelo.- Un modelo es una abstracción de algún aspecto de un problema; expresado con varias clases de diagramas
Modelos de Datos. Vehículo para describir la realidad (batin/Ceri/Navathe)
Modelo Entidad – Relación
En 1976 Peter Chen publica “The Entity – Relationship Model – toward a unified view of data”
Este modelo diferencia a los objetos, de quienes representamos datos, en entidades y relaciones, añadiendo semántica y sencillez grafica.
ENTIDAD
Una entidad es un objeto concreto o abstracto existente y distinguible de otros. Se representa por un rectángulo y se le nombra con un nombre en singular, que hace referencia a la instancia y no al conjunto de entidades del mismo tipo.
[pic 2]
ATRIBUTO
Dato (abstracción) para identificar o describir una entidad. Se representa con un nombre (del dato)
dentro de una elipse unida o “conectada” por una línea a la entidad asociada.
RELACION
Instancia o elemento del conjunto relación entre dos o más conjuntos de entidades.
Se representa por un rombo “conectado” a las entidades relacionadas.
CARDINALIDAD.-La cardinalidad indica el número de instancias (uno o muchos) de una entidad en relación a otra entidad. Tu puedes elegir los siguientes valores para la cardinalidad:
- Uno – a – uno : Una instancia de la primera entidad solo puede corresponder solo a una instancia de la segunda entidad.
[pic 3]
- Uno – a – Muchos : Una instancia de la primera entidad puede corresponder a mas de una instancia de la segunda entidad.[pic 4]
- Muchos – a – Muchos : Mas e una instancia de la primera entidad puede corresponder a mas de una instancia de la segunda entidad.
[pic 5]
Punto Terminal | Existencia | Cardinalidad | Debe existir | ||
Mandatoria | Uno | Uno y solo Uno | |||
[pic 6] | Mandatoria | Muchos | Uno o Muchos | ||
Opcional | Uno | Uno o Ninguno | |||
Opcional | Muchos | Ninguno o Uno o muchos | |||
¿Qué es el Diseño de Base de Datos?
Es el proceso mediante el cual se define la estructura Lógica y Física de una Base de Datos que cubra los requerimientos de información de los usuarios en una Empresa u Organización Elmasri,1997)
La estructura lógica es la descripción de los datos que se almacenaran en la base de datos sin considerar aspectos de implementación. La estructura física es la descripción de los datos considerando el SGBD (Sistema Gestor de Base de Datos) especifico y detalles de almacenamiento físico. En la estructura lógica se define que se almacenara mientras que la estructura física como se almacenara.
...